Vitaliy recently had the pleasure to be a guest on the Value Perspective Podcast by Schroders.

In this wide ranging conversation, Vitaliy talks about how he discovers mental models, the risks of linear thinking, and shares an embarrassing story about his time in Italy. Enjoy!
